Abstract

Light module (1) for a vehicle headlamp, comprising: a light source and a reflector (2), wherein the reflector (2) comprises a first reflector surface (3) and a second reflector surface (4), wherein the first reflector surface (3) and the second reflector surface (4) are configured to reflect light, wherein light reflected from the first reflector surface (3) forms a low beam light distribution, wherein the first reflector surface (3) and the second reflector surface (4) are adjacent to each other and separated by a borderline (5), wherein the borderline (5) has a given shape, wherein the light module comprises a shading element (6) arranged in the light path of the light source, wherein the shading element (6) has an edge (7) corresponding to the shape of the borderline (5), so as to block light in such a way that only said first reflector surface (3) is located in the direct light path of said light source.

Background
Light modules for vehicle headlamps, wherein the light module comprises a light source and a reflector, are well known. Typically, the light source is configured to illuminate the entire reflector in order to produce a certain light distribution.
A disadvantage of the known light module is that stray light from the light source is also reflected by the reflector, thereby negatively affecting the desired light distribution.
SUMMERY OF THE UTILITY MODEL
Therefore, it is an object of the present invention to improve a light module for a vehicle headlamp.
To achieve this, a light-shielding element is arranged in the light path of the light source, wherein the light-shielding element has an edge corresponding to the shape of the borderline, blocking the light in such a way that only the first reflector surface is located in the direct light path of the light source.
Advantageously, the shading element blocks stray light from the light source, which would otherwise be reflected by the reflector and thus impair the desired low-beam light distribution. Since only the first reflector surface is located in the direct light path of the light source, a low-beam light distribution can be formed without generating unwanted reflected stray light.
A light blocking element may be provided comprising a light absorbing material.
It may be provided that the reflector has a mounting hole and the shading element has a mounting means, wherein the mounting means is configured to engage with the mounting hole in such a way that the shading element is mounted to the reflector.
It may be provided wherein the mounting means comprises a snap fit. This ensures a simple and cost-effective way of mounting the shading element to the reflector.
The light module may further comprise a cooling element, wherein the cooling element is in thermally conductive contact with the light source for cooling the light source, wherein the shading element is mounted to the cooling element.

Detailed Description
Fig. 1 shows a light module 1 for a vehicle headlamp, which includes a light source (not shown) configured to emit light onto a reflector 2 and the reflector 2 configured to receive light from the light source and reflect the light. In the embodiment shown, there are three light modules 1 arranged adjacent to each other. Each reflector 2 comprises a first reflector surface 3 and a second reflector surface 4, wherein the first reflector surface 3 and the second reflector surface 4 are configured to reflect light. The light reflected from the first reflector surface 3 forms a low beam light distribution. The first reflector surface 3 and the second reflector surface 4 are adjacent to each other and separated by a borderline 5, wherein said borderline 5 has a given shape.
In the exemplary embodiment shown, the central and right-hand lighting modules 1 have a shading element 6 arranged in the beam path of the light source. The light-shielding element 6 has an edge 7 corresponding to the shape of the borderline 5, blocking light in such a way that only the first reflector surface 3 is located in the direct light path of the light source. The second reflector surface 4 is not located in the direct light path of the light source, and therefore, when the light source is switched on, the second reflector surface 4 does not receive light and is not illuminated.
The shading element 6 may comprise a light absorbing material.
The reflector 2 has a mounting hole and the shading element 6 has a mounting means, wherein the mounting means is configured to engage with the mounting hole in such a way that the shading element 6 is mounted to the reflector 2.
Fig. 2 shows a detail of the shading element 6 mounted to the reflector 2.
As shown in fig. 3, the mounting means may be a snap fit 8.
